Solution for 3x+4x=3x+3 equation:


Simplifying
3x + 4x = 3x + 3

Combine like terms: 3x + 4x = 7x
7x = 3x + 3

Reorder the terms:
7x = 3 + 3x

Solving
7x = 3 + 3x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-3x' to each side of the equation.
7x + -3x = 3 + 3x + -3x

Combine like terms: 7x + -3x = 4x
4x = 3 + 3x + -3x

Combine like terms: 3x + -3x = 0
4x = 3 + 0
4x = 3

Divide each side by '4'.
x = 0.75

Simplifying
x = 0.75
